‘War ended, thanks to TRUMP’: Armenia, Azerbaijan to sign peace pact at White House; US president takes credit

Donald Trump declared that Armenia and Azerbaijan are set to sign a peace agreement. The agreement aims to end decades of hostility. It includes joint economic ventures. A transit corridor, the Trump Route, is planned. This will connect Azerbaijan to Nakhchivan. The Karabakh region has been a conflict zone. Azerbaijan reclaimed Karabakh in September 2023.

THIS is the most dangerous room in the house, according to a top cardiologist

Dr. Dmitry Yaranov reveals the bathroom as the most dangerous room. Straining during bowel movements, especially with constipation, triggers the Valsalva maneuver. This reduces blood flow to the heart and brain. People with heart conditions face higher risks. Constipation affects many, particularly women. Increase fiber intake, drink water, and exercise regularly to prevent it.
